The Role of Machines in Cow Dung Fertilizer Making

In the quest for sustainable agriculture, cow dung has long been treasured as a natural fertilizer that enriches soil and boosts crop yields. However, the traditional methods of processing cow dung into organic fertilizer can be labor-intensive and time-consuming. Enter the era of mechanization, where machines play a pivotal role in streamlining and speed up the production of cow dung organic fertilizer.

Machines bring a level of efficiency and consistency to the cow manure fertilizer production process that manual labor alone cannot achieve. A significant advantage of using machinery is the ability to dispose of large volumes of cow dung in a shorter period. This increased efficiency not only saves time but also reduces labor costs, making the cow dung fertilizer production more economical for farmers and producers.

Mixer machines are essential in this process, ensuring that cow dung is thoroughly combined with other organic materials, such as straw or compost, to create a nutrient-rich blend. These machines guarantee a uniform composition, which is crucial for the effectiveness of the fertilizer. Additionally, cow manure granulation machines are employed to convert the processed mixture into granules or pellets. Furthermore, manure drying machines play a crucial role in reducing the moisture content of the cow dung fertilizer. Proper drying not only extends the shelf life of the product but also prevents the growth of harmful microorganisms that could affect the quality of the fertilizer.
